California State University, Stanislaus
Social Media and Marketing Student Assistant
California State University, Stanislaus, California, Missouri, United States, 65018
Job Description
Duties
Assist in planning, creating and scheduling content for social media platforms (Instagram, Facebook, LinkedIn, TikTok, etc.).
Capture and edit photos / videos for digital marketing campaigns and social posts.
Support event marketing efforts, including on-site social media coverage and live updates.
Write compelling captions and copy tailored to each platform.
Engage with online communities by responding to comments, messages and mentions.
Help monitor social media trends and analytics to optimize engagement.
Perform administrative tasks related to social media and marketing projects.
Collaborate with the MarCom marketing and social media team to brainstorm ideas and identify student stories, accomplishments and other opportunities to share and elevate student voices.
Represent the MarCom team at campus-wide student resource events.
Serve as a brand ambassador.
Other duties as assigned.
Preferred Qualifications
Photography or video editing skills are a bonus.
Working knowledge of Adobe Creative Suite and Microsoft Office software.
Strong writing and communication skills.
Ability to work independently and meet deadlines.
Ability to communicate in a professional manner with campus community contacts, including current and potential donors.
Self-motivated, good organizational skills, detail-oriented, ability to prioritize, multi-task and meet deadlines.
Required Qualifications
Undergraduate students must be registered / enrolled in a minimum of six (6) Fall / Spring units.
Post-baccalaureate students in a graduate program must be registered in a minimum of four (4) Fall / Spring units.
Experience with Social Media Platforms and Content Creation
Familiarity with social media content editing tools (e.g., Canva, Adobe Express, CapCut, or similar).
Salary Range $16.50 per hour.
